What does "grant" mean?

  1. verb To give someone permission, a right, or something they have asked for.
    "The landlord granted permission to sublet the flat."
  2. verb To accept something as true for the sake of argument.
    "I'll grant you that the plan has some merit, but the cost is still too high."
  3. noun A sum of money given, often by a government or organization, to fund a project or support someone.
    "She received a research grant to study coral reefs."
